    Since this version of the rail has the sling loop cutout the designation is GKR-10MS.

    Installation was pretty straightforward and not that difficult save for the layers of rattle can paint built up on my handguard retainer. The front locking piece is not toleranced for the extra material. The fit is very precise. There is no wobble in the handguard once fully installed.

    I know that the Magpul MOE (all polymer) 7.62x39 AK mags were originally billed as being suitable for training/fun use only, due to the lack of steel reinforced locking lugs, compared to the Gen M3 version. But years later, has actual heavy use confirmed that to be the case? Or are the MOE mags virtually “good enough?”

    Also, does anyone know if there is any difference in fragility between the 20 round and 30 round MOE mags? For I noticed Magpul doesn’t seem to make a 20 round Gen M3. Might this be because 20 rounders are less prone to broken lugs due to the reduced leverage, or something like that?

    I’m tempting fate but I haven’t had an AK pmag fail yet. I’ve run them in classes and range days since 2015. A handful of mine are original gen1 mags. I have a bunch of the gen2 30’s, a half dozen 20’s and a few of the M3’s. They fit in every gun I own, including milled.
